    ART DIRECTOR The art director is in charge of the overall visual appearance and how it communicates visually‚ stimulates moods‚ contrasts features‚ and psychologically appeals to a target audience. The art director makes decisions about visual elements used‚ what artistic style to use‚ and when to use motion. An advertising art director is not necessarily the head of an art department.
